Description
Queso Fundido is a hot, melty cheese dip loaded with spicy chorizo and gooey, stringy cheese, served bubbling straight from the oven. It’s bold, smoky, and irresistibly delicious, perfect for dipping with warm tortillas or crispy chips!
Ingredients

For the Queso Fundido:
- 1/2 lb Mexican chorizo, casings removed
- 1 small onion, finely diced
- 1 jalapeño, finely chopped (optional, for spice)
- 2 cloves garlic, minced
- 1/2 teaspoon cumin (optional, for extra flavor)
- 2 cups shredded Oaxaca or mozzarella cheese (for that stretchy pull!)
- 1 cup shredded Monterey Jack or cheddar (for extra flavor)
For Garnish:
- Fresh cilantro, chopped
- Diced tomatoes or pico de gallo
- Sliced jalapeños (for extra heat!)
For Serving:
- Warm flour or corn tortillas
- Tortilla chips
- Salsa or guacamole
Instructions
Step 1: Cook the Chorizo
- Preheat oven to 400°F (200°C).
- Heat a cast-iron skillet or oven-safe pan over medium heat.
- Add chorizo and cook, breaking it apart, until browned and crispy (5 minutes).
- Stir in onion and jalapeño, cooking until soft (2-3 minutes).
- Add garlic and cumin, stirring for 30 seconds until fragrant.
Step 2: Melt the Cheese
- Turn off the heat and spread the cooked chorizo evenly in the skillet.
- Sprinkle shredded cheeses on top, covering the chorizo.
Step 3: Bake Until Bubbly
- Transfer the skillet to the oven and bake for 10-12 minutes, until the cheese is fully melted and bubbly.
- For a golden, slightly crispy top, broil for 1-2 minutes at the end.
Step 4: Serve Immediately!
- Garnish with chopped cilantro, diced tomatoes, and sliced jalapeños.
- Serve hot and melty with warm tortillas or tortilla chips.
- Enjoy by scooping the queso into tortillas or dipping chips straight in!
Notes
✔ Want it spicier? Add extra jalapeños or a drizzle of hot sauce.
✔ More flavor? Mix in smoked paprika or a splash of beer for depth.
✔ No chorizo? Use crumbled bacon, sautéed mushrooms, or black beans.
✔ Make it ahead? Assemble everything, refrigerate, then bake just before serving.
